This thing is probaby the best money I ever spent. it looks so factory and completely outa the way of the t tops.
It mounts with 3 pieces of wood that are attached to factory drilled holes its pretty slick for the mounting.
Here's my setup
Kicker DS6.5 2 sets
Kicker 10" CVT 2 ohm
Kicker ZX350.4 for the component sets
Kicker ZX400.1 for the sub
Subthump amp rack
DoubleD 10" drivers stealth box
4ga soundquest power and rca cable's
Pioneer 4300DVD headunit
I wish I had gone a little higher end on the component sets, but for 75 a pop they will work okay. With all the wiring I have about a grand into it so its a very budget system.
